I came across this site and decided to see if someone might be able to help me. I have 9 payday loans out and am stuck. Here are the loans I have:
1. United Cash Loans - Original Amount = $200. I have paid $240 to date in interest.
2. Paycheck Today - Original Amount = $300. I have paid $500 to date and still owe $150 on the actual loan.
3. Cash Advance Network - Original amount = $400. I have paid $480 in interest only.
4. Impact Cash - Original amount = $300. I have paid $270 in interest.
5. US Fast Cash - Original amount = $350. I have paid $210 in interest.
6. Prestigage Marketing - Original amount = 300. I have paid $270 in interest.
7. Loan Shop - Original amount = $300. I have paid $180 in interest.
8. Sagamore - Original Amount = $300. I have paid $180 in interest.
9. Eagle Finances - Original Amount $300. I have paid 410 and still owe 250 on the loan.

I am also starting to recieve debits on my account from companies I don't know or have any paperwork on. One of them is signmyloan. The only loans I signed up for are the ones listed above. I am not sure why I have others debiting my account.
All of the loans are internet and I live in IL.
Thank you in advance for any help.

I thought that Sagamore had given you a PIF, or was I mistaken? As for UsFastCash, set up nothing with them. Have you already paid back what they deposited into your bank account? If so, they get nothing further. Your bank account is closed so they can't get into that, which is a good thing. If it persists, contact Intercept EFT, ask for Cindy. Talk to her and then let UFC know that you have done so. I think that MNE is getting tired of the calls to the processor and they are starting to cut their loses before they can't do business any longer. If you really do owe $140, after all is said and done, then that is exactly what you should pay. They'll get over it.

What does one do if there is no contact info? After phone conversation, I was to get $300 deposited (which they did) under the condition that it was to be repaid in FULL (plus $90.00 service fee.) Instead, they have debit my acct $90.00 twice, which means they aree dragging this out by taking $90 every 2 weeks (apparently to extend the loan) instead of taking payment in full. They never sent me any e-mail, so I have no way to reach them, by mail or phone. Anyone have any info/advice? They come up as PDL Loan Center.

This is what you call a "verbal contract/agreement" which is absolutely bogus and Illegal. You need to revoke that $90 debit with your bank immediately or put your account on "deposit only" status. They will not stop and continue to debit your account.

Looks like you paid them $180 so far. All you owe them is $120 more and you are done. They will call as soon as they cannot get the funds.
